The Harvard interview happened to be with the person who led an local reception in September. I had talked with her a little at the event. When she came to get me for my interview today, she said she recognized me. Also, once I knew it was her that was going to be interviewing me, I became much less nervous because I knew she was not likely to be too tough based on my past interaction with her and her personality. HBS is known for occasionally conducting stress interviews. She went out of her way to make sure I was comfortable (adjusting the blinds and such.) It was in her office. There was a table and two round chairs. We first talked about the weather in my city as compared to Boston and she encouraged me to be conversational in the interview. Mostly basic questions. No curve balls.
